Nestled in the scenic Powys region of Wales, Llangammarch train station offers a unique charm that's hard to find anywhere else. This quaint station caters to those looking for a peaceful getaway from bustling city life. As a vital stop on the Heart of Wales Line, it provides an essential link between rural communities and larger urban areas. Planning a trip to or from Llangammarch? Let us guide you through what to expect at this modest yet important station.
Llangammarch station is unstaffed, which means there’s no ticket office or ticket machines available. It's important to plan ahead and purchase your tickets online if you’re starting your journey here. Although smartcards and validators are not an option at this station, an induction loop is present for those requiring auditory assistance. The absence of other amenities like waiting rooms, toilets, and refreshment facilities hints at the station's minimalistic setup. Nevertheless, there is a seating area where you can take a breather while waiting for your train. For those who drive, the car park maintained by Transport for Wales offers four spaces and one accessible option, free of charge.
The station provides step-free access to the platform via a slight slope from the car park, categorized as B1, offering some accessibility to travelers with reduced mobility. While it lacks facilities such as accessible toilets or ticket machines, the platform is accessible and there is a ramp available for train access. For assistance, it's recommended to arrange for support in advance through the Passenger Assist service, ensuring a smooth journey for those requiring extra help.
Although Llangammarch Station doesn’t offer local bike hire or storage, it does provide essential links for onward travel. The rail replacement bus service stops at the station entrance, offering an alternative means of travel during any rail service disruptions.

Netley station, nestled in the picturesque village of Netley Abbey, Hampshire, is more than just a practical transit spot—it's a gateway to local history and stunning seaside views. Whether you're a regular commuter, a visitor soaking in the sights of the south, or simply someone keen on exploring rail travel across the UK, Netley provides a reliable and straightforward starting point. Let's dive into what the station offers and where your journey could take you.
Netley station is designed with passenger convenience in mind, even if some areas are a bit basic. Ticket purchases and collections are straightforward, with a ticket office open from 06:10 to 10:10 on weekdays complemented by ticket machines that remain accessible. If you've bought your tickets online, you can easily collect them at the station.
For passengers requiring assistance, step-free access is provided, although interchange between platforms involves using a footbridge with steps. While there’s no staffed assistance available, help points are strategically located for querying or emergencies. Those with mobility impairments can also book support in advance or speak to the guard present on the train upon arrival. Wi-Fi hotspots are available to use, keeping you connected as you wait for your train.
Moving on from Netley is convenient. If you find yourself in need of bus services, detailed information in printable format is just a click away here. For rail-replacement services, the station forecourt is the designated location.
Dreaming about your next destination? From Netley, a variety of intriguing places await. Comfortably reach vibrant Southampton Central or head towards historical sights at Portchester. Trips to the glistening waters of Portsmouth Harbour or bustling London Waterloo are all within easy grasp with a direct train service. For more localized jaunts, places like Bursledon, or the flight-hub of Southampton Airport Parkway, are just a short trip away.
For those more concerned with accessibility, Netley station makes efforts to address these needs. The station does not have wheelchair rentals nor staffed amenities but does offer some level of accessible amenities, including induction loops and a designated accessible car parking space. CCTV is in operation at the station to ensure passenger security.
